Virtualization – Introduction – (Containerization)-setup-LXC


What does Virtualization mean?

The simple explanation is that you create a virtual version of something that’s generally used for some type of execution. For example, if you were to partition a basic hard drive to create two hard drives, then they would be two ‘virtualized hard drives,’ as the hardware is technically a single hard drive that was digitally separated into two.Virtualization refers to the creation of a virtual resource such as a server, desktop, operating system, file, storage or network.

what are Containers?

Containers are a lightweight virtualization technology.In IT it is all about the need to run an application, not a virtual machine.In the end, it is the application user that has a need.This need is to run the application and no user will ever ask for a virtual machine.That is exactly one of the major design goals of the container technology.

A container is a virtualization method at the OS level.This allows multiple instances of an os to be running on the same kernel, which allows for a more efficient usage of available resources.

